Preparing for Your Used Car Test Drive

Buying Franklin used cars can seem intimidating at first. Alexander Automotive takes pride in keeping the process transparent and pain-free. That’s why we encourage you to do plenty of research before you arrive, and ask as many questions as you need to once you’re here. Besides that, there’s one more thing that’s vital to buying a car of any age, which is why we’re about to tell you how to ace the test drive.

Take Notes

Your needs, from a long commute to the number and kind of passengers you expect, will dictate certain features and amenities. Your research is likely to uncover a few more. Make a list, since these details will help your dealer match you to the right fit.

  • Type of vehicle

  • Make and model

  • Trim level or options

  • Priority items (seating room, cargo space, a good sound system)

  • Special considerations (a long commute, an impending addition to the family, and the like)

Get Ready

Once you’ve settled on a vehicle or category, it’s time to prepare for your visit to our used car dealership in Franklin, TN.

  • Bring your license and proof of insurance

  • If you’re trading in, bring the vehicle title, owner’s manual, and as much maintenance history as you can locate

  • If you’ll be applying for financing, bring proof of residence, proof of employment, and any other supporting documentation

  • If you’re stuck at any point in the process, call ahead and we’ll help

Get Behind the Wheel

Now it’s time to climb in and take your car for a spin. It’s important to drive the way you would on any other day (within reason; safety first, please). As you do, evaluate the following:

  • Acceleration from a dead stop, as well as power when passing or merging

  • Steering response

  • Brake feel

  • Cabin layout and ergonomics

Understanding Used Car Safety Ratings

Before visiting Franklin dealerships for used cars, some research is in order. Besides the usual items — body styles, models’ repair histories, reviewers’ and owners’ opinions — many of us are concerned with safety. While safety data is scant for many classic cars, when shopping the more recent used cars at Alexander Automotive, it’s worth checking their scores from the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) and Insurance Institute for Highway Safety (IIHS).

NHTSA Safety Ratings

The NHTSA is a part of the US Department of Transportation that investigates safety issues, underwrites car safety research, suggests best practices for vehicle safety, and tests vehicles for collision survivability. It’s a broad mandate, but this agency helps keep us safer in new and used cars.

A car’s NHTSA rating aggregates scores in the Frontal Crash, Side Crash, and Rollover safety categories, among others. For now, NHTSA testing doesn’t score on active safety technology, although they recommend that drivers take advantage of these features when available.

IIHS Safety Ratings

The IIHS is an independent nonprofit organization funded by the insurance industry with two goals: keeping cars safe and insurance premiums low.

The IIHS tests five different criteria:

  • Small overlap front

  • Moderate overlap front

  • Side

  • Roof strength/rollover

  • Head restraints/rear crash

Look for cars with top “Good” scores in each category. A Top Safety Pick is awarded when a car gets “good” marks on all tests, while the Top Safety Pick Plus is awarded to vehicles with the most advanced — and effective — driver-assist aids.

How Does This Figure Into Used Car Research?

Rating criteria change as vehicle construction changes, so a car from 2000 wasn’t tested quite the same way as one from 2017. The ratings aren’t infallible (especially since they don’t cover classics), but they’re still a good guideline to use before you pick your next used car.
